Description
John Daniel, a member of Congressman John Joseph Moakley’s congressional committee staff from 1989 through 2001, discusses the career of Congressman Moakley. His interview covers how he became a member of the House Rules Committee staff; Congressman Moakley’s relationships with his colleagues on Capitol Hill; how the political climate has changed since Moakley was in office; the issues he worked on as a staffer for Congressman Moakley; and Moakley’s legacy of public service and political leadership.
